Question:

If ∝ + ß = \(\frac{π}{2}\) and ∝ : ß = 2 : 1 then ratio of tan∝ to tanß is?

Options:

\(\sqrt {3 }\) : 1

3 : 1

1 : 3

2 : 1

Correct Answer:

3 : 1

Explanation:

∝ + ß = \(\frac{π}{2}\)

⇒ 2\(x\) + \(x\) = \(\frac{π}{2}\) ⇒ 3\(x\) = \(\frac{π}{2}\)

\(x\) = \(\frac{π}{6}\)

tan∝ = tan\(\frac{π}{3}\) = \(\sqrt {3}\),

tanß = tan\(\frac{π}{6}\) = \(\frac{1}{\sqrt {3 }}\)

tan∝ : tanß = \(\sqrt {3 }\) : \(\frac{1}{\sqrt {3 }}\) = 3 : 1
